The first and most important thing to do when it comes to checking your 0500 flight status is to utilize the resources available to you. Most airlines offer a variety of options for checking the status of your flight, including their website, mobile app, and even text message notifications. By utilizing these resources, you can stay updated in real-time on any changes to your flight, allowing you to adjust your plans accordingly.

Another interesting fact about 0500 flight status is that it’s not just the airline that can cause delays or cancellations. Weather, air traffic control issues, and even mechanical problems can all affect the status of your flight. This is why it’s crucial to stay informed and be prepared for any changes that may arise.

One way to ensure that you’re always in the loop when it comes to your 0500 flight status is to sign up for flight status alerts. Many airlines offer this service, which sends you notifications via email or text message about any changes to your flight. This can be a lifesaver when it comes to staying informed and being able to make alternative plans if necessary.

In addition to staying on top of your 0500 flight status, it’s also important to know your rights as a passenger in the event of a delay or cancellation. The regulations vary by airline and by country, but in general, you may be entitled to compensation or assistance if your flight is significantly delayed or cancelled. By familiarizing yourself with your rights, you can ensure that you’re prepared to advocate for yourself in the event of a disruption to your travel plans.
